Idaho borders Wyoming to the east, Montana to the northeast, Nevada and Utah to the south, Washington and Oregon to the west, and British Columbia, Canada to the north.
Colorado is bordered by Wyoming to the north, Nebraska to the northeast, Kansas to the east, Oklahomato the southeast, New Mexico to the south, Utah to the west, and Arizona to the southwest at the Four Corners.
